Description
Pyecombe is a quintessential Sussex village, surrounded by beautiful countryside. The historic 12th-century church sits at its heart, the local pub and an array of countryside walks on your doorstep yet conveniently located for Brighton & Hove, Hassocks Station and the A23 to London / Gatwick. This property is tucked away at the south end of the close, shared with just three other detached family houses, giving it a real sense of privacy. The driveway provides parking for two cars.
Inside, a central entrance hall sets the tone with engineered oak flooring, neutral décor, and plantation shutters throughout. The ground floor is designed for modern family living, with a generous living room and a full-depth kitchen/dining room—both opening onto the garden via bi-fold doors, perfect for entertaining in the summer. A third reception room provides flexibility as a study, playroom, dining room, or even a fifth bedroom. The living room also features a wood-burning stove, adding character and warmth.
The kitchen is the heart of the home, with white cabinetry, black granite worktops, and integrated Bosch appliances including, dishwasher, dual ovens, microwave, and gas hob. A new fridge freezer has also been fitted. The utility room with rear access keeps laundry and muddy boots out of sight.
The garden is family-friendly yet easy to maintain, with lawn, a sunken trampoline, and space for outdoor dining and gatherings. Though technically north-facing, it benefits from open east-west aspects, meaning plenty of sunshine year-round. A spacious garage can be accessed from both the garden and the front.
Upstairs, a galleried landing leads to four double bedrooms, all with fitted wardrobes. The master bedroom includes an en suite shower room and built-in storage, while the family bathroom features a bath and separate rainfall shower. Rear bedrooms enjoy views of the South Downs, while the front looks over the peaceful close.
With its modern design, generous living space, and village setting, this is a wonderful family home offering both comfort and practicality.
